    The first step is an easy method to find songs used on YouTube, but it's one that many people overlook. You'll often see credits for copyrighted music in video descriptions. YouTube adds this information automatically when it detects licensed music. This is part of the Content ID system that allows copyright owners to claim their videoson YouTube. ...

    If the music you want to identify from a video has lyrics, you don't need Shazam for YouTube just yet. Simply listen carefully for the words in the song, then search for a line or two of the lyrics on Google.   4. Jun 26, 2023 · Go to YouTubes official website by typing the website URL in the address bar. Now, search and select the YouTube video that you want to put on repeat or loop mode. Right-click anywhere on the video and select Loop from the pop-up menu. That’s it, now the video will play in a repeat loop on YouTube.
